Mobile application development is the whole process of building application purposes that run with a mobile device, plus a typical mobile application utilizes a network link to work with distant computing sources. Therefore, the mobile development method consists of making installable program bundles (code, binaries, belongings, etc.) , implementing backend companies including information obtain with the API, and screening the appliance on focus on devices. Mobile application development is the process of generating software package applications that operate with a mobile gadget, in addition to a standard mobile software utilizes a network relationship to work with distant computing sources.
Embarking on the journey of iOS development needs a potent grasp of foundational programming principles. Like constructing a creating, one should lay a strong Basis before shaping the higher levels.
Many key criteria are important to guarantee An effective and successful backend system when acquiring a backend support for mobile app development.
Every time a mobile app is opened, it communicates With all the product's working system and other software package components to utilize its components and services, such as the camera, GPS, and internet connection. This enables the application to provide its unique features and expert services for the user.
Tests Right after Updates: Extensively exam the application after updating dependencies to capture any compatibility issues or new bugs released by updates.
PWAs are Internet apps that benefit from a set of browser capabilities - including Performing offline, functioning a background method, and adding a website link for the device dwelling screen - to provide an 'application like' user expertise.
These back again-close products and services are typically accessed by way of several different software programming interfaces, most commonly often known as APIs. You can find different types of APIs, for example REST and GraphQL, and There's also numerous types of suggests and models of accessing them. While some back again-conclusion support APIs are offered on to the applying via phone calls within the platform alone, many of the specialised expert services ought to be built-in into your app by way of a software program development package, normally called an SDK.
What certifications and qualifications can I generate by means of mobile application development classes on Coursera?
The Android mobile software development system permits you to make use of your existing Google account to produce a developer account, spend the USD 25 cost and submit your software.
It's possible you’ll create a Instrument you could use by yourself to transform your workflow. Or perhaps you’ll just get a completely new talent that lands you an awesome task!
The technological realm is marked by its quick pace of modify. What’s applicable these days could possibly be obsolete tomorrow. As an aspiring iOS developer, it’s not nearly attaining abilities but about remaining up to date, normally becoming about the cusp of innovation.
This may provide the text label the name “helloButton” and may point out that the tactic “onHelloButtonClick” will reference this look at. We’re going to increase that to our code in a instant.
Normally, a Relaxation API is accustomed to connect with info resources over the cloud, like a cloud databases. A GraphQL API is additionally an alternative choice for developers, since it makes effortless to operate with backend info in a very mobile application.
The software can be preinstalled this site over the machine, downloaded from a mobile app store site or accessed by way of a mobile Net browser. The programming and markup languages used for this kind of program development consist of Java, Swift, C# and HTML5.
For more information, contact me.